Ihab Al-Rifai (Al Dhafra Region) - Support for 3 student projects in the field of innovation and artificial intelligence Ihab Al-Rifai (Al Dhafra Region)Nasser Mohammed Al Mansouri, Undersecretary of the Ruler’s Representative Court in Al Dhafra Region, inaugurated the second health forum for Al Dhafra Hospitals on Tuesday morning under the auspices of the Ruler’s Representative Court in Al Dhafra Region.
The forum will continue for three consecutive days at the Baynunah educational complex in Zayed City under the slogan “Al Dhafra: A healthy community”. The opening was attended by Brigadier General Hamdan Saif Al Mansouri, Director of the Al Dhafra Police Directorate, Mohammed Ali Al Mansoori, General Manager of Al Dhafra Region Municipality, Brigadier General Khalfan Bati Al Qubaisi, Director of Residency and Foreigners Affairs - Al Dhafra Region, Rashed Saif Al Qubaisi, Head of Corporate Affairs of the Purehealth Group, and Hamad Khamis Thiban Al Mansouri, Executive Director of the Administration of Al Dhafra Hospitals. Jaber Ali Al Marar, Executive Director of the Support Services Department in Al Dhafra Hospitals and the Chairman of the organising committee of the second health forum, explained that the forum witnessed a large turnout from members of the health professions and the community in Al Dhafra.
More than 55 government and non-government entities are participating in the exhibition to present the latest innovative developments and products in the health profession, he added. Over 25 speakers led practical workshops and medical lectures, and more than 18 activities were held at the forum’s interactive stage.
The forum, which aims to showcase Al Dhafra Hospitals’ and the SEHA Company’s achievements and plans for the next fifty years, spread health awareness and education, and keep up to date with the innovations in medical practice and the latest artificial intelligence applications.
Further, the forum aims to enhance cooperation educational institutions and strategic partners and support students. According to Al Marar, the forum includes three main activities. The first targeted medical and technical professionals and includes a scientific conference and various workshops with more than 25 speakers.
The second activity included an exhibition where participating entities can showcase the latest medical devices, equipment, educational programmes, and health care services to the public, which witnessed a great turnout from the public. The third activity involves an innovative platform for companies and institutions can display educational and awareness programmes. Also under the third activity, the most important innovative projects were shown to a large audience.
Dr. Hamda Salem Al Neyadi, Acting Director of Marketing and Corporate Communications at SEHA, said that three different student projects were displayed and given financial support with the aim of encouraging students’ innovation. The selected student projects include a deaf translation project and smart hand project from the Emirates Foundation for School Education in Al Dhafra region, in addition to the smart sorting room project from the Higher Colleges of Technology students.
